This episode is really getting to me. Matt brings Elena to the Stoner Pit at school, where both Vicki and Jeremy have left their marks. When he shows Elena Vicki's mark, they reminisce about how Jeremy was so into Vicki after the Gilbert parents died. Matt is all choked up as he tells Elena that he found Vicki's tag after she died. "It made me smile." Oh honey, that offer of a blanket and some warm pudding still stands. Next Matt shows Elena a little heart with a J + V in it. Jeremy wrote that. His voice still thick with emotion, Matt talks about the denial he went through when Vicki's body was found. "There was no possible way she could be gone forever, and then she wasn't." His point is that sometimes in their crazy town, you can't accept someone is gone because they're not completely gone. He tells her it is okay to hope, "...because sometimes that's all that keeps me going." In order to not cry, I'm just going to point out that this seems contrary to his Snap Elena Out of It mission, but Matt has been living with this loss for however much time has elapsed on this crazy show. I think my Poor Pudding Pop can't bear to burst his best girl's bubble. Stefan calls Elena just then and reports that Damon found Bonnie. Their plane is waiting for them. They'll be home in a few hours. Then he tells Elena she might be right. There might be something Bonnie can do. They'll have to see what Bonnie says when she gets home.

Rebekah has Vaughn in the cave, now. He's still tied up. He encourages her to use the Bore to kill Silas, but Rebekah's not interested in that. As she starts to leave, Vaughn cautions her because Silas is running around up above. When he tells Rebekah to look in his pack, she finds Silas's death mask. Vaughn tells her no one has seen Silas's face. "How do you hide from the devil when you don't know what he looks like? Who knows? Maybe I'm him. Mark my words. If you don't use the cure to kill him, it doesn't matter if you're human or vampire. You are doomed. We all are." Rebekah drops the mask and Stealth-Salvatores out of the cave. Vaughn calls after her, "Good luck to ya, lass. You've all brought this upon yourselves. May you rot in it! Ha ha ha."
